Dr. Govindarajan
Dr. Govindarajan"Rapid advancement in technology and knowledge is allowing for tailored invasive approaches to heart rhythm problems."

Board Certification:

  • CFMG Certification (valid indefinitely)
  • Board Certified in Internal Medicine - 2000
  • Board certified in Cardiovascular Disease - 2004
  • Board Certified in Nuclear Cardiology - 2006
  • Board Eligible in Cardiac Electrophysiology

Society Memberships:

  • American College of Cardiology
  • American Medical Association
  • Heart Rhythm Society

Experience:

  • Staff Cardiologist, Danville V.A. Illiana Medical Center, Danville, IL
  • Fellowship in Cardiac Electrophysiology, Advocate Illinois Masonic Medical Center, Chicago, IL
  • Fellowship in Cardiology, Michael Reese Hospital, University of Illinois, Chicago, IL
  • Residency in Internal Medicine, Michael Reese Hospital, University of Illinois, Chicago, IL

Education & Training:

  • Masters Degree in Preventative Medicine, University of Iowa, Iowa City, IA.
  • Medical Internship, Madras (Chennai) Medical College, Madras, Tarnilnadu, India
  • M.B.B.S. (Medical Degree), Madras (Chennai) Medical College, Madras, India

Awards & Honors:

  • Teacher of the Year - University of Illinois at Urbana - Champaign Residency Program, IL - 2004-2005
  • Special Award for a unique contribution to the V.A. - 2004-2005
  • Chief Fellow - Electrophysiology Fellowship - 2007-2008
  • Chief Cardiology Fellow - 2002-2003

Research Experience:

  • Abstract Presentation: "Does Left anterior descending artery (LAD) disease account for the prologation of QT dispersion (QTd and QTed) in Coronary artery disease." - Presented to the Midwest Chapter of the American College of Cardiology.
  • Fellow Coordinator for the "Xanadu" trial at Michael Reese Hospital (2002-2003).
  • Assimilation and Analysis of Data, on utilization of reperfusion therapy in patients presenting with chest pain at Michael Reese Hospital, a participating center for the National Registry of Myocardial Infarction (NRMI) of the American Heart Association (Jan 2001 to Jan 2003)
  • Abstract submitted for acceptance to Heart Rhythm Society Meet 2008 - "Atrial Tachycardia Ablation in the Non Coronary Aortic Sinus".

Licensure:

  • State of Florida
  • State of Illinois
